Global Tubing opens Canadian service center

OE Staff
Thursday, March 28, 2013

Texas-based coiled tubing provider Global Tubing, opened a new service center in Red Deer, Alberta, Canada, last month. The1709 sq m facility will house two full indoor service lines, and provide coiled tubing services including spooling, welding, hydrotesting, preventative maintenance, asset management, repair and wireline injection services.
